The study attempts at evaluating the share in the state taxes as a source of income for independent cities in the times of economic crises, from the perspective of desirable characteristics of these cities’ incomes. What results from the analysis is that the income from the share in the state taxes is characterised by neither stability nor certainty. It is flexible and consequently – it decreases in the times of economic downturn. This is proved by numerical data concerning the total income of independent cities and the incomes of the cities of Szczecin and Poznań in 2003−2009 (the first 6 months).

The aim of the paper was to present the behaviors of young consumers in the market of the chocolates and the bars. These behaviors related to the location, the size and the frequency of purchases, the expenditures on these products, the preferences and other individual factors important for buying this product group. Empirical study was conducted in May 2007 by The Internet Research Institute in collaboration with CEM. The authors purchased the data in the form of a report. Chocolates and bars were often purchased by all young consumers, while those within 25–30 years age group more often declared their choice of chocolates, while the younger preferred the bars. The bars were purchased more frequently than the chocolates, which in the case of young consumers with limited financial resources can be combined with the lower one-time expenditure. An important reason for buying chocolates and bars, was to address the need to eat something sweet or fulfill hunger, and also the potential improvement of humor and wellbeing. Among the important factors influencing the purchase of chocolates and bars taste, price and brand were indicated. The preferred type of chocolate was milk chocolate.

According to the results of carried survey, despite the world financial crisis of 2007–2009, dining out still remains a popular activity among inhabitants of Tricity. Fast food and casual dining are the two segments of gastronomy market which have been gaining more and more interest in the time of recent economic slowdown. Franchise chains companies have also been strengthening their position. It is evident, that most of the customers of gastronomy market prefer to spend more money and receive a fairly higher quality product. World’s financial crisis implicates various repercussions in many different branches. Evolution of preferences and changing behavior shall be resulting in soon reorganization of gastronomy services in Tricity.

E-commerce is highly influenced by such factors as the development of the Internet in a given country as well as by the access of its population and the companies functioning in the country to the Internet. E-commerce may be conducted among various companies and in different spheres, out of which sphere B2C – business to consumer – has been very quickly developing recently; although, it is mentioned to occupy the second position, after B2B sphere – business to business. It may be observed that the more widespread access to the Internet on the part of households in a given country is the more important e-commerce in the B2C sphere becomes. The example of e-commerce in Switzerland supports well the above mentioned observation, as Switzerland is the country where there is observed a very widespread access of households to the Internet – in 2009 37% of the adult population made use of e-commerce at least once a year.

Purpose of this paper is the comparative analysis of the health protection expenditures in Poland and other countries of the European Union. The analysis was concentrated on two basic indicators showing the level of the health protection financing: total expenditure on health protection as percentage of GDP and per capita total expenditure on health protection at international dollar rate. One examined also the participation of public and private expenditures in financing of the health protection in countries of EU. The analysis includes 2000 and 2004 Years. The level of the health protection expenditures, on both in the account to GDP and in per capita, was in examined years in countries of EU diverse, especially large disproportions appeared in the seizure per capita. The health protection financing in Poland to with other countries characterizes the extra-low level, both absolute rates (per capita expenditures in USD) as and relative (percentage of GDP) locate our country on final positions among countries of EU. Poland locates high only in case of the participation of private expenditures in entire expenditures on the health protection.

Stanowisko nr 2 (dalej st. 2) w Bieniądzicach zostało oznaczone początkowo na arkuszu Archeologicznego Zdjęcia Polski 77–43 w dokumentacji dostarczonej przez Fundację Badań Archeologicznych im. Prof. Konrada Jażdżewskiego jako 9. w kolejności, natomiast na mapie obwodnicy Wielunia otrzymało nr 15. Odkryte podczas badań powierzchniowych w 2006 r. przez mgr. Bogusława Abramka i Waldemara Golca z Muzeum Ziemi Wieluńskiej w Wieluniu nie zostało poddane wcześniejszym badaniom sondażowym, a jego położenie i zasięg zostały ustalone na podstawie rozrzutu ruchomego materiału archeologicznego. Ponowne badania powierzchniowe przeprowadził w 2006 r. mgr Tadeusz Kołomański z „Pracowni Archeologiczno-Konserwatorskiej” z Jeleniej Góry. Odkryta, czy też raczej zweryfikowana podczas tych badań osada, otrzymała nr 43 na arkuszu AZP 77–43 i 2 w miejscowości. Prace archeologiczne w Bieniądzicach na zlecenie Generalnej Dyrekcji Dróg Krajowych i Autostrad Oddział w Łodzi wykonywała Fundacja Badań Archeologicznych im. Prof. Konrada Jażdżewskiego w Łodzi. Były one prowadzone w trzech etapach: od 2 VII do 17 VIII 2007 r., następnie od 10 X do 12 XII 2007 r. i wreszcie etap końcowy od 12 V do 6 VI 2008 r. Kierownikiem całości badań w terenie był mgr Marek Urbański, a współpracowali z nim: mgr mgr Aleksandra Krawiec, Aleksandra Lachmayer, Anna Piestrzeniewicz, Zofia Urbańska i Jacek Ziętek.

The article focuses on the concept of man as a human person in the diocesan periodicals of the north-eastern region of Poland after 1989. Its fundamental purpose was to give an answer to the question: What press sources can be found for the cognizance of the concept of man as a human person after 1989, can be found in the leading periodicals of the two Church provinces of north-eastern Poland: Bialystok and Warmia? These provinces include the following dioceses: Białystok, Drohiczyn, Elbląg, Ełk, Łomża and Warmia. The main source for the analysis of this issue has been press material from two weekly newspapers: “Głos Katolicki” (“Catholic Voice”) from the years 1993-2009 (about 1000 issues) and “Niedziela Podlaska” (“Sunday of Podlasie”) from the years 1994-2009 (about 950 issues); the biweekly magazine “Posłaniec Warmiński” (“Messenger of Warmia”) from the years 1989-2009 (about 600 issues); three monthly magazines: “Martyria” from the years 1992-2009 (about 250 issues), “Wspólnota” (“Community”) from the years 1992-2002 (about 150 issues) and “Białostocki Biuletyn Kościelny” (“Bialystok Church Bulletin”) and from the later periodicals of the Archdiocese of Białystok: “Czas Miłosierdzia” (“Time of Mercy”) and “W służbie Miłosierdzia” (“In the service of Mercy”) from the years 1993-2009 (about 250 issues). From all of the texts, there emerges a picture of the human person as being something singular, special, unique, the image of God himself. Whereas an image in principle captures the essence of its archetype. Therefore, human existence has no meaning apart from God. That is why one cannot reduce man to the world only. Emphasized is also the fact, that the human being is a physical-spiritual being and thereby is the undisputed subject of values and rights of the human person, even in those periods when physically not able to demonstrate them or to enforce them.

Confirmation is referred to as the sacrament of Christian initiation. But it happens that after receiving this sacrament, a certain number of people experience a decrease in religious-life activity and a departure from the Church community. Thus the sacrament of Confirmation is sometimes called the sacrament of parting with the Church. In order that such a “farewell” not take place in the Diocese of Łomża – certain initiatives have been taken up, which have as their aim the deepening of the faith at the moment of preparation for Confirmation. The article contains the results of empirical studies carried out among teenagers living in villages and attending school in Piątnica, that received the sacrament of Confirmation in 2010. Indicated in the text are the elements most effectively influencing their religious life and those that require additional precision.

The above study deals with a question of religiousness of the modern Brazilian society. The paper provides analysis of changes in religiousness of the Brazilian society. Shown were their ties to Catholicism and characterized were religious practices of Brazilians faced with changed religion. Furthermore, pointed was out the phenomenon of a growing number of the people that call themselves “people without religion” and analyzed was a society participating in the Afro-Brazilian religious practices. The data for the analysis was provided by Census of the year 2000 (Censo 2000); the study conducted by CERIS, study commissioned by National Bishops’ Conference of Brazil (CNBB), as well as by partial analyses of Census 2010. The last, for obvious reasons, provide only partial data, since full disclosure of Census 2010 will not be available until the second half of the year 2012.

Wizytacje biskupie zwane także lustracjami miały i mają do dzisiaj nie tylko na celu kontrolę parafii i proboszczów, ale także wzmocnienie życia religijnego w tych małych wspólnotach wiary. W warunkach swobody religijnej stanowią, co kilka lat, ważny element kontaktu biskupa z wiernymi należącymi do jego diecezji i są jedną z form jego działalności duszpasterskiej. Natomiast w Rosji carskiej, szczególnie na Ziemiach Zabranych, w dobie tzw. pierwszej rewolucji miały one także charakter restytucji katolickich wspólnot parafialnych, a w szerszym wymiarze, walki o prawa religijne, narodowe i społeczne ludności katolickiej.

Zakład Handlu Wojewódzkiego Związku Gminnych Spółdzielni „Samopomoc Chłopska” w Łodzi Oddział w Wieluniu powstał 2 stycznia 1959 r. w wyniku procesu reorganizacyjnego, mającego swe źródło w likwidacji Centrali Tekstylnej w Wieluniu. Po przekazaniu przez Powiatowy Związek Gminnych Spółdzielni „Samopomoc Chłopska” w Wieluniu części dystrybucji artykułami obuwniczo-skórzanymi, nowoutworzona jednostka rozpoczęła swą działalność. Zakład zajmował się obrotem towarowym, prowadzonym przede wszystkim w środowisku wiejskim. Zaopatrywał placówki handlowe powiatu wieluńskiego, pajęczańskiego, sieradzkiego i radomszczańskiego (po likwidacji tamtejszego Zakładu) w artykuły włókiennicze (wełniane, bawełniane, lniane) oraz obuwniczo-skórzane. Miał więc duże znaczenie i międzyregionalny charakter
